This is cool but there's a downfall in trying to lock all engagement into one area. The biggest by far is limiting social engagement to those that use YouTube on a regular basis. A large chunk of my videos come from other sites embedding the content, thus, most of the engagement takes place on that particular site. It seems like that's a better fit than trying to engage via YouTube.

The pro about this is that it can lend to higher engagement from creators themselves with their subscribers. That's a big plus for YouTuber fans that want to feel a bit more exclusive. We'll see how it goes.
